警告:找不到引用的组件"Microsoft.Office.Core"

Yuy*_*uyo 16 c# ms-office visual-studio-2010 visual-studio

在构建我的一个项目时,我收到以下警告:

Warning 3   Cannot find wrapper assembly for type library "Microsoft.Office.Core".
Warning 4   The referenced component 'Microsoft.Office.Core' could not be found.    
Run Code Online (Sandbox Code Playgroud)

奇怪的是,构建失败没有错误.上面的警告似乎是问题所在.从Windows Update安装了一些Office 2007更新后,这种情况就开始发生了.在此之前它正在建设一切都很好.

有没有人遇到过同样的问题?有关如何在不修改项目的情况下解决此问题的任何想法?

在这些更新之后,我的项目停止了构建

这是Microsoft.Office.Core的引用属性

参考清单

小智 9

您的参考文件很可能已更新为新版本,因此无法找到当前版本.

单击"项目****属性\引用"并删除一个无法找到的确定.


Nic*_*ick 0

它似乎是一个 COM 引用?我猜想更新导致参考被认为是过时的。

如果是这样,我会考虑手动构建互操作并签入它们,然后添加对互操作的引用。缺点是会将问题从编译时转移到运行时。